Dr Frank Igbojindu Akpoazaa donates solar borehole to his community in Okija
The CEO of Akpoazaa Foundation, Dr Frank Igbojindu (Akuyienwata Egwu na Okija), has donated a solar-powered borehole to his community Ubahuagboba in Okija, Anambra State.
This project, according to the Educational consultant was conceived to provide sustainable and reliable water sources to the residents and address critical water scarcity issues faced by the community.
The inauguration ceremony which took place on April 27, 2025 brought together community leaders, residents, and representatives from the Akpoazaa Foundation.
During the event, Dr Igbojindu emphasized the importance of clean water for health and development, stating, “Access to safe drinking water is a fundamental right. Our goal is to empower communities by providing sustainable solutions that improve their quality of life.”
